Our research focus on enhancing cognitive function and up-limb rehabilitation in stroke patients using our digital occupational training system. We aim to evaluate its effectiveness in improving cognitive ability, up-limb function, and daily living skills. Current challenges include helping new patients adjust to the system, as it represents a new approach that requires some time to learn.
Therefore, it is important that therapists receive comprehensive training in the use of this system and provide proper guidance to patients. Our protocol is more efficient and effective than traditional methods. It uses find games for personalized therapy and better patient focus.
It also requires important data like test performance, completion time, and motion tests. Useful for later rehab evaluations.
